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

 
Reply to this topicStart new topic
> [php/mysql] Pętla wypisująca zawartośc tabeli
alogator
post
Post #1





Grupa: Zarejestrowani
Postów: 158
Pomógł: 0
Dołączył: 13.11.2006
Skąd: Sosnowiec

Ostrzeżenie: (0%)
-----


Witam mój problem polega na tym że nie umiem napisać pętelki, która wyświetlałaby mi nazwiska z jednej tabeli (wszystkie które sie w niej znajdują) a pod nimi informacje o wypisanym użytkowniku, które pobierane są z drugiej tabeli. Wspólną kolumną jest kolumna ID.

Tabela A
ID
Nazwisko


Tabela B
ID
Imie
Data_ur


a wynik chciałbym uzyskać w formie:

Nazwisko 1
imie 1, data ur 1

Nazwisko 2
imie 2, data ur 2

itp...

Prosze o pomoc!
Go to the top of the page
+Quote Post
JaRoPHP
post
Post #2





Grupa: Zarejestrowani
Postów: 675
Pomógł: 15
Dołączył: 7.11.2004
Skąd: Katowice

Ostrzeżenie: (0%)
-----


Na czym polega problem? Na skonstruowaniu zapytania, czy na prezentacji wyników?
Zakładam, że to pierwsze - zapoznaj się z składnią JOIN.

Zapytanie (w uproszczeniu) może wyglądać tak:
  1. SELECT tabA.nazwisko, tabB.imie
  2. FROM tabelaA AS tabA
  3. LEFT JOIN tabelaB AS tabB ON (tabA.ID = tabB.ID)


EDIT:
Poza tym, dość dziwnie zbudowana jest ta baza, skoro podstawowe informacje o użytkownikach rozdzielasz na przynajmniej dwie tabele. Zastanów się czy nie wystarczyłaby jedna.

Ten post edytował JaRoPHP 24.06.2007, 12:56:34
Go to the top of the page
+Quote Post

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 15.09.2025 - 14:58